Corruption refers to an act performed by an individual or a group, which seriously compromises the rights and privileges of someone else or the public in general. “Corruption” includes a significant number of illegal and immoral activities from different areas of governance and administration. Corruption is not only limited to the government and its agencies but, it also includes private businesses and organizations. Corruption severely hampers the growth and development of a society and a nation as a whole. A corrupt system makes people lose general trust in the government, resulting in an environment of fear and chaos.

Nowadays, lots of benefits are given by the government of India to the poor people on the basis of various rules and regulations to bring social awareness among common people as well as equality in society. However, poor people are not getting benefited from those advantages given by the government as many officers doing corruption secretly in between the channel before reaching to the poor people. They are doing corruption against law for just fulfilling their own pockets with money.

There are many causes of corruption in society. Nowadays political leaders are making interest oriented programs and policies instead of nation oriented programs and policies. They are just wishing to be famous politicians for completing their own interests instead of citizen’s interests and requirements. There is an increasing level of change in the value system in the human mind as well as decreasing the ethical qualities of human beings. The level of trust, faith, and honesty is decreasing which gives rise to corruption.

The number of common people with increased tolerance power towards corruption is increasing. There is a lack of strong public forums in the society in order to oppose corruption, widespread illiteracy in rural areas, poor economic infrastructure, etc are the reasons for endemic corruption in public life. Low salaries norms of the government employees force them towards the channel of corruption. Complex laws and procedures of the government distract common people to get any type of help from the government. During election time, corruption becomes at its highest peak. Politicians always take the support of poor and illiterate people by dreaming them big in the future during their governance however nothing happens after the win.

In India, there has been a trend of giving and take means to give some money in order to get your work done whether in the government offices or private sector offices. And now the condition is getting worse and worse, as earlier, the money was paid for getting wrong works done or only work to be done, but currently, money is paid for getting works done in the right ways and at right time. Even after paying complete money according to the demand, there is no full chance of getting things done at the time and in the right way.
